Lubricating System (Patent No: 301840)

Inventor: Warner, Wellington Lyon

Location: Calgary

Comments: N/A

Description: Wellington Lyon Warner, Calgary, Alberta, Canada, 8th July, 1930. Filed 13th November, 1928. Serial No. 343,344.

Claim.—1. The combination in a lubricating system, a pump, a suction pipe with a check valve therein intermediate a source of lubricant and the said pump, discharge pipe from the said pump, each of same having therein a measuring device comprising a cylinder, a spring influenced pinion working loosely in the said cylinder and a check valve, all substantially as specified.

2. The combination in a lubricating system, a pump, a suction pipe with a check valve therein intermediate a source of lubricant and the said pump, discharge pipes from the said pump, each of same having therein a measuring device comprising a cylinder with a portion of its bore restricted to form two valve seats, a loosely fitting piston slidably engaged in the said cylinder in the end nearest
the pump the said piston being spring influenced from the adjacent valve seat, a check valve in the other end of the cylinder comprising a ball and spring, the whole being adapted that lubricant supplied by actuation of the pump will be measured by the displacement of the loosely fitting piston.

3. In combination with a lubricating system, a measuring device comprising a cylinder with a portion of its bore restricted to form a double valve scat, a loosely fitting piston in relation to one of the valve seats yieldably supported from the valve seat by a spring, a ball and spring in relation to the other valve seat forming a check valve, the whole being adapted to pass measured quantities of lubricant through the system.

Claims allowed. 3.
